#d130bb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d130bb is composed of 82% red, 18.8% green and 73.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 77% magenta, 10.5%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 308.2 degrees, a saturation of 63.6% and a lightness of 50.4%. #d130bb color hex could be obtained by blending #ff60ff with #a30077. Closest websafe color is: #cc33cc.

Shades and Tints of #d130bb

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020001 is the darkest color, while #fcf1f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#d130bb

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#837e82 is the less saturated color, while #f809d7 is the most saturated one.
